What's The Definition Of Destroyed?

[adj] spoiled or ruined or demolished; "war left many cities destroyed"; "Alzheimer's is responsible for her destroyed mind"
[adj] destroyed physically or morally

Synonyms | Synonyms for Destroyed: annihilated | blasted | blighted | blotted out | broken | burned | burned-out | burnt | burnt-out | demolished | desolate | desolated | despoiled | devastated | dismantled | done for(p) | exterminated | extinguished | fallen | finished | gone(a) | impoverished | kaput(p) | lost | obliterate | obliterated | pillaged | raped | ravaged | razed | ruined | sacked | scorched | shattered | spoilt | tattered | totaled | war-torn | war-worn | wasted | wiped out(p) | wrecked
